Debugger ruby mine keygen

In addition to general performance improvements, the new version of ide brought new icons, a dark theme for macos, support for the touch bar, improved support for js, typescript and coffeescript, which you can see in the overview of the webstorm 2018. Rubymine product key additionally incorporates grammar and mistake featuring and code designing alongside code refactoring and expectation activities. This is a smart tool that allows you to complete rules in several languages. It provides you with innovative features for applications, web development, and phones too. Press and hold down the shift key the dialog title changes to debug. The key to this is that your source code exists in both environments and that. Graphical ruby debugger full ruby and rails applications investigating support in intellij ideas attempted and genuine debugger ui. There is at least 1 open issue involving breakpoints but it seems the problem lies with the vscode extension not the su debugger dll. I confess that this mode of operation is usually not how i use the debugger.

It is implemented by utilizing a new ruby tracepoint class. The rubydebug ide gem provides the protocol to establish communication between the debugger engine such as debase or rubydebug base and ides for example, rubymine, visual studio code, or eclipse. But from then on, you can run debug everything from it. Rubymine includes a standard debugger that has minimal setup and works out of the box. The ide has full fledged support for ruby and ruby on rails projects. Rubymine vs visual studio code what are the differences. Here 54515 port is for internal communication between debugger. Rubyminea s ruby debugger inherits all the best from the proven intellij idea javajsp debugger while focusing on the needs of ruby and rails developers. Hello, i am new with the use of rubymine and i have a problem with debugging in sketchup 2018. Aug 22, 20 join anna bulenkova in debugging ruby program with the tools available in rubymine. If youre using jruby, than you might be just fine sticking with windows development environment.

There are a number of situations where calling the debugger at the outset is impractical for a couple of reasons. Debugging rails applications in rubymine is as easy as debugging scripts you can set breakpoints and run the rails server in debug mode. Apr 01, 2020 rubymine prier key incorporates the smart ruby coding assistance which is a canny ruby code proofreader, with complete ruby coding help, savvy, scopebased and typemindful code finishing. Rubymine can feel fast and lightweight while still giving you some nice extra features. I would also be very grateful for any other help in figuring out why the breakpoints arent having any effect in my sketchup extensions. Cannot get rubymine to run or debug anything follow. To do this, press ctrl twice and type the configuration name remote debug. Add a remote ruby interpreter, configure mappings between files of the local and remote project, and start a debugging session. By default system ruby will be selected, which you might dont want to use. I changed it on the command line to be something else via sudo hostname newname. Apr 11, 2020 jetbrains rubymine 2020 eap crack with keygen free download full latest version. The newest version of rubymine, the complete ide to ease your coding experience for ruby on rails framework, offers a plethora of features to improve your productivity.

Start learning to code for free with real developer tools on. Rubymine ide download free for windows 10, 7, 8, 8. May 30, 2009 ive tried all of the above except for remote debugging, but it didnt help. Every person can write the code but the good way is that to write some special code which works advanced of top level code. Debug rubymine provides a debugger for ruby code, including the erb and haml files. Rubymine 2020 keygen incorporates the smart ruby coding assistance which is an astute ruby. Komodo ide crack with license key free download komodo ide 11. It brings the majority of tools that are the useful developing shop.

You can set breakpoints and run your code step by step with all the information at your fingertips, without having to modify your code as pry. Jetbrains rubymine keygen a comprehensive ruby code editor aware of dynamic language specifics. I havent found any good example how to use remote debugger for rails applications so ive written this post. I initiated the debug process from rubymine problem.

With intelligent assistance for debugging, testing, code completion, and syntax checking, jetbrains has taken an important step to empower software writing teams, supporting the most used version control applications out there. Dec 19, 2019 ruby debug overview ruby debug is a fast implementation of the standard debugger debug. The debugger stops before the first line of executable code and asks for the input of user commands. Rubymine offers you two ways to debug applications that are run on the. Rubymine is a significant and practical ruby and rails ide specially designed for developers who need to create a convenient environment for productive web development. Jetbrains rubymine 2020 eap crack with keygen free download full latest version. You can quickly open all the gems you are using and debug them with visual debugger. The ruby debugide gem provides the protocol to establish communication between the debugger engine such as debase or ruby debugbase and ides for example, rubymine, visual studio code, or eclipse. Despite a general disdain for the debugger in the ruby community, the ruby debugger is a powerful tool that can quickly get to the heart of a coding.

Rubymine debug error sketchup pro 2018 ruby api sketchup. Debugger should stop execution on that line when youll make a right request. In such cases, you can use the ruby remote debug rundebug configuration. Which gems need to debug application with ruby mine, i tried use these gems. Are there any step by step guides on how to install and configure rubymine in such a way that i can debug a simple. Then, it returns answersevents received from the debugger engine to the ide. It has made web development easier, faster and more efficient. Remote debug ruby on rails running in a docker container. Ruby installs with its own repl, which is irb, that youve.

Actually ruby debug ide gem provides java api for listening ruby process in debug mode. How to set up rubymines remote debugging feature to debug a ruby on rails. When i try to run my rails console in debug mode in rubymine, which it. Hi, i cant seem to get rubymine to do anything, even with simple code.

Rubymine jetbrains crack latest version free download. Many of the problems experienced by our users when using the debugger in rubymine are actually caused by bugs in those gems. If youre developing ruby applications on windows id strongly recommend you to use a virtual machine and install ruby there. Automated yet safe refactorings help clean your code and keep it more maintainable. Nov, 2010 during the last week weve been working hard on improving rubymine built in debugger and here are some results. When rails app is running you can set breaking points inside rubymine with clicking on a pane, left from line of code you want to debug. Mar 04, 2020 use the powerful ruby, javascript, and coffeescript graphical ui debugger. Rubymine brings a sophisticated debugger with a graphical ui for ruby, js, and coffeescript. Rubymine offers you two ways to debug applications that are run on the remote machine. In order to start the ruby debugger, load the debug library using the commandline option r debug. Jan 30, 2020 if these gems are not installed, rubymine will suggest doing this when you run debugging for the first time.

Rubymine 2020 crack brings an entire scope of designer instruments, all firmly incorporated together to make an improvement domain for beneficial ruby advancement and web advancement with ruby on rails. As every programmer already knows, this framework also requires an integrated development environment ide. Perhaps a strong contributor to part of the underutilization, even for those who have already chosen to use rubymine, is the fact that remote debugging can be tricky to set up and. It offers you advanced features for software, web development, and phones as well. Debug the application using ruby remote debug rubymine. As you may know rubymine uses rubydebugbase and rubydebugide gems inside its graphical debugger. To help deal with bugs, the standard distribution of ruby includes a debugger. Rubymine brings dedicated ror features including project structure views, quick modelviewcontroller navigation options, railsspecific code completion, intention actions, and automated refactorings. How can i use rubymine debugger in sinatra app ides. This program is intended for web engineers, web developers, and web designers. Trying to learn ruby with rubymine, but the debugger doesnt. Rubymine 2020 keygen incorporates the smart ruby coding assistance which is an astute ruby code supervisor, with. The rubymine debugger provides various ways to examine the state of a.

Cannot get rubymine to run or debug anything ides support. I consider rubymine a good ide, and based on my experience with ruby on rails teams, i cant help but feel like rubymine and its debugger. With a simple project configuration, automatic management of ruby gems, rake and integrated support consoles, has everything a developer needs a ruby development environment. It doesnt matter how easy a language is to use, it usually contains some bugs if it is more than a few lines long. One of the main advantages of ides over text editors is the debugging experience. Therefore, code completion cutouts and an electronic computer. Which gems do i need to debug a rails application in rubymine. Cant debug in rubymine cannot connect to the debugged process in 10s follow. Among the innovations improving the work with the code, support for new version managers, retesting only for failed tests and much more. Komodo can debug ruby programs locally or remotely. See this answer, only 2 debug gems are needed versions will be different for ruby 1. In this post, well look at debugging in rubymine on os x. Thank you for supporting the partners who make sitepoint possible. I consider rubymine a good ide, and based on my experience with ruby on rails teams, i cant help but feel like rubymine and its debugger is an underutilized jewel.

It sharp looking segment you can move at whatever point at any region of your code. It provides breakpoint handling, bindings for stack frames among other things. With the help of your smarter and more reliable partner you just found right now in jetbrains rubymine. Jetbrains is one of the best organizations out there that is reshaping the manner in which we code, the manner in which things take a shot at the digital world at the root level by furnishing the software engineers with all the incredible, savvy ides on various stages. It brings almost all useful tools for developing shop. Vscode debugger attaches, but breakpoints are ignored. You can makes the coding with excellent context to. For the first time it will take some time for rubymine to download all installed gems you have. It provides the entire selection of sophisticated facilities which one o one inspections that are incorporated into ide. Faster debugging with rubymine macros makandra dev. Rubymine crack is the most intelligent ruby rails software.

The fastest way to debug ruby especially rails code is to raise an exception along the execution path of your code while calling. You can patch the system or project config file to enable debugging. Cant debug in rubymine cannot connect to the debugged. Running the rails debugger in a docker container using. Hello everyone, were excited to announce rubymine 2016.

To add a debugger to your code, start by requiring debug in your program def say word require debug puts word end. Jetbrains rubymine crack is a real ruby on rails ide that carries the pallet completely materials required the developer, ruby and productive development and development with rubymine the web we track. It gives a high solution to ruby and rails, javascript and, html, css, sass and so on. Ive consumed about 4 hours today just trying to get this to work, whether its been running commands via cmd in the devkit to completely reinstalling rubymine. The core component provides support that frontends can build on. No console output in ide when running dockercompose application in debug mode. Jul 11, 2017 major summer update of the integrated development environment rubymine from jetbrains under the number 2018. Probably you tried to open application on debugger port 54515 on screenshot instead of web server port 4567. Irb and rails console dont run with dockercompose sdk. It has made comfortable to navigate or search by codes.

Jan 18, 2012 mastering the ruby debugger by jim weirich. To learn more about debugging a sample rails application, check out this getting started guide. The faster execution speed is achieved by utilizing a new hook in the ruby c api. I still dont enjoy debugging, but rubymine has made it much less painful. Since i believe everyone could benefit from having. Provides intelligent coding assistance, intelligent code refactoring and deep analysis capabilities code. For general information about using the komodo debugger, see komodo debugger functions. Boost your productivity for all types of ruby projects and cuttingedge technologies with rubymine, a powerful ide with smart coding assistance and advanced testing and debugging features. Youll be able to get ruby debugger debug output info when running debug session in console. In my rubymine i have recorded two macros for debugging and linked them to some keyboard shortcuts.

Jan 05, 2011 debugging ruby on windows using rubymine january 5, 2011 june 22, 2016 rob prouse rails, ruby, rubymine most of the installation instructions for the ruby debugger that i found were out of date for windows, so i thought it would be useful to document how i got it working. The simple environment of jetbrains rubymine 2017 mac crack has attracted many users. Note that older ruby versions for instance, ruby 1. This article is written about how one can use rubymine to remote debug a ruby on rails application that even runs inside a docker container. Rubymine 2019 crack is an entire set of specially intended for programmer productivity. The instructions below describe how to configure komodo and ruby for debugging. Ive been following the rubymine tutorial on github. This will cause ruby to interrupt execution and show a prompt when the say method is run. Dont show run anything in the available editor shortcuts in idea with ruby plugin. Mastering the ruby debugger by jim weirich youtube.

Database inspector, terminal access, debugger, vcs integrations. If these gems are not installed, rubymine will suggest doing this when you run debugging for the first time. Rubymine free download together society and ultimate version eap build can be secondhand for any reason, counting writing proprietary or saleable application. Debugger driven developement with pry by joel turnbull. Smart ruby with the features currently on it, as well as its support for the related applications.

Debug the application using ruby remote debug rubymine offers you two ways to debug applications that are run on the remote machine. Join anna bulenkova in debugging ruby program with the tools available in rubymine. That upgrade can provide more precise featuring of ruby and haml code mistakes with different repairs for greater edition control techniques integration. The rubymine debugger provides various ways to examine the state of. A powerful debugger finetuning application code is an essential step in every software project. Debugging ruby on windows using rubymine rob prouse. That provides the best integrated development environment for the user. Jetbrains rubymine 2020 eap crack with keygen full latest. Here is a complete list of commands, which you can use while debugging your program. The ide provides smart coding assistance, intelligent code refactoring, and deep code analysis capabilities. This library provides debugging functionality to ruby. It brings almost all useful tools for developing sho.

1141 1494 569 288 1438 1243 622 1275 1282 916 88 1561 352 1137 57 1391 400 1513 124 21 931 1542 495 235 361 1485 69 894 68 548 1048 1412 467 529 153 1558 1382 716 348 471 297 646 200 227 163 519 1106 584